BRIEF: Suspects sought in Danville home invasion
Jan 26, 2013 (Danville Register & Bee - McClatchy-Tribune Information Services via COMTEX) --
Danville police are investigating a home invasion on Baugh Street early Saturday morning.
At about 12:30 a.m. Saturday, Danville officers responded to a report of a home invasion in the 100 block of Baugh Street, according to a news release from the Danville Police Department.
"Several Danville residents reported two unknown subjects knocked on their back door and when the door was opened they entered the house," the news release stated. "It was two black males wearing red bandannas and both were armed with silver handguns."
When one of the residents ran out the house calling for help the suspects ran out the back door, police said.
Nothing was taken and there were no injuries reported in this incident.
The police investigation is ongoing.
